Hi Hessa,

I would be happy to share my thoughts on your question:

  • The case book from Yale Graduate Consulting Club is, in my opinion, one of the best existing case books. Other notable case books you might have a look at are from Columbia, Darden, Fuqua, Kellogg, LBS, McCombs, Michigan, Ross, and Sloan.
